Rising Demand for Technical Textiles in Healthcare

The healthcare industry is a major driver of growth for the Technical Textile Market Industry. Technical textiles are used in a wide range of medical applications, including surgical gowns, drapes, and masks; wound dressings; and implantable devices. The increasing demand for these products is being driven by a number of factors, including the growing number of surgeries being performed, the aging population, and the rising prevalence of chronic diseases. Technical textiles offer a number of advantages over traditional materials used in healthcare applications.They are strong, durable, and resistant to chemicals and fluids.

They are also lightweight and breathable, making them comfortable to wear. In addition, technical textiles can be treated with antimicrobial and antiviral agents to help prevent the spread of infection. The growth of the healthcare industry is expected to continue in the coming years, which will drive demand for technical textiles. This growth will be particularly strong in emerging markets, where the population is growing, and the healthcare infrastructure is improving.

**Technical Textile Market Fiber Insights  **

The Fiber segment is a critical component of the Technical Textile Market, with a revenue projection of USD 112.3 billion in 2023. It encompasses various fiber types, each with unique properties and applications. Synthetic Fibers, including Polyester, Nylon, and Polypropylene, dominate the segment, accounting for over 60% of the market share. Their strength, durability, and resistance to chemicals make them ideal for applications in automotive, construction, and filtration.

Natural Fibers, such as Cotton, Linen, and Wool, offer comfort, breathability, and biodegradability, finding use in medical textiles, apparel, and home furnishings.Glass Fibers, known for their high strength and thermal insulation properties, are widely used in composites, wind turbine blades, and aerospace applications. Carbon Fibers, with their exceptional strength-to-weight ratio and electrical conductivity, are employed in high-performance composites for automotive, aerospace, and sporting goods. Ceramic Fibers, renowned for their heat resistance and chemical stability, are utilized in high-temperature applications such as kiln linings and heat shields.

Woven Textiles (Dominant) vs. Nonwoven Textiles (Emerging)

Woven textiles represent the dominant segment in The Global Technical Textile Market, characterized by their strength, durability, and versatility across a range of industries. These textiles are manufactured using interlacing threads, providing structural integrity and a broad scope of applications including automotive, aerospace, and industrial uses. With advancements in weaving technology, the quality and performance of woven textiles have significantly improved, enabling tailored solutions for specific market needs. On the other hand, nonwoven textiles are emerging rapidly, valued for their economical production process and adaptability. They are increasingly utilized in sectors such as hygiene products, medical applications, and construction materials. This segment’s growth trajectory is driven by technological advancements that enhance performance while meeting the demand for sustainable and disposable options.
